How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Birdshill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Birdshill Studio Apartments | $1,319 | $1,095 | $1,480 |
| Birdshill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,707 | $995 | $3,700 |
| Birdshill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,242 | $1,295 | $5,400 |
| Birdshill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,931 | $1,695 | $6,005 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
